CAS 15178-71-9
:N,N-dimethylundecylamine N-oxide
Description:
N,N-Dimethylundecylamine N-oxide is a surfactant and a member of the class of amine oxides, characterized by its quaternary ammonium structure. It features a long hydrophobic undecyl chain, which contributes to its surfactant properties, making it effective in reducing surface tension and enhancing wetting. This compound is typically a colorless to pale yellow liquid with a mild odor. It is soluble in water and various organic solvents, which allows it to function well in both aqueous and non-aqueous systems. N,N-Dimethylundecylamine N-oxide exhibits good foaming properties and is often used in personal care products, detergents, and industrial applications. Additionally, it is known for its mildness, making it suitable for formulations intended for sensitive skin. The compound is also biodegradable, which is an important characteristic for environmentally friendly formulations. Its amphiphilic nature allows it to interact with both polar and non-polar substances, enhancing its utility in various chemical processes and formulations.
Formula:C13H29NO
InChI:InChI=1/C13H29NO/c1-4-5-6-7-8-9-10-11-12-13-14(2,3)15/h4-13H2,1-3H3
SMILES:CCCCCCCCCCCN(=O)(C)C
Synonyms:- Dimethyl(Undecyl)Amine Oxide
